T-SQL Query | [ Finding the missing Gaps Puzzle ]
The puzzle is simple. Here you have to find the missing gaps between sequential numbers. Please check out the sample input and expected output for details.
Sample Input
num |
1 |
2 |
3 |
6 |
8 |
11 |
12 |
13 |
15 |
17 |
28 |
Expected output
GapStart | GapEnd |
4 | 5 |
7 | 7 |
9 | 10 |
14 | 14 |
16 | 16 |
18 | 27 |

Script
Use the below script to generate the source table and fill them up with the sample data.
CREATE table findGaps (num int) insert into findGaps select 1 union all select 2 union all select 3 union all select 6 union all select 8 union all select 11 union all select 12 union all select 13 union all select 15 union all select 17 union all select 28 GO CREATE CLUSTERED INDEX Ix_Num ON findGaps(num) |
UPDATE – 11-Apr-2015 – Solution 1
-- --Sol 1 SELECT GapStart + 1 GapStart , GapEnd - 1 GapEnd FROM ( SELECT num GapStart , LEAD(num,1,0) OVER (ORDER BY Num) GapEnd , LEAD(num,1,0) OVER (ORDER BY Num) - num Gap FROM findGaps ) a WHERE Gap > 1 -- |
Execution Plan below – Its a clean plain execution plan with some simple maths calculation.
